Sonogram Tech Work Description<\/strong><\/h3>\n

\"PartridgeThere are various acceptable titles for ultrasound techs (technicians). They are also called ultrasound technologists, sonogram techs, and diagnostic medical sonographers (or just sonographers). Regardless of name, they all have the same basic job function, which is to carry out diagnostic ultrasound testing on patients. While many practice as generalists there are specializations within the profession, for instance in pediatrics and cardiology.
